The Second Grade Blasts off into Space!



At the beginning of the school year, the entire 2nd grade did an in-depth unit study on space.  We researched planets (there are only 8 by the way), we made and shared very creative projects including a powerpoint, models of the solar system, alien masks, posters,satellites, and informative "sun" boxes.  We ate banana rockets, visited the Huntsville Space and Rocket center, read a variety of literature about the solar system, illustrated space jokes, tryed on a real astronaut uniform, and kept research notes in a space booklet. We learned a lot and had fun in the process.  Ask your child if they can remember the way to remember the order of the planets!!!
